What you can expect

Embark on a thrilling walking tour through London’s most stunning Royal Park and conquer Primrose Hill for breathtaking city views.

Regent's Park, often regarded as the jewel in the crown, is one of London's eight Royal Parks. Originally established as a royal hunting ground, the park was thoughtfully designed by John Nash in the 1800s.

Explore a variety of attractions, including the picturesque Avenue Gardens, the renowned Queen Mary’s Gardens, the tranquil Boating Lake, Regent’s Canal, and the scenic Primrose Hill Park. The park also features the newly opened Queen Elizabeth II Garden, which opened to visitors in April 2026.

Discover the rich history of Regent's Park and learn about its iconic buildings and notable residents. This distinguished park offers a unique blend of natural beauty, heritage, and cultural significance.
